Otsego Electric Coop Wins $3.9M For Internet Upgrade

Otsego Electric Coop Wins $3.9M For Internet Upgrade Based in Hartwick, Otsego Electric Cooperative has been serving customers since 1941. HARTWICK – Otsego Electric Cooperative will be receiving $3.9 million from New York State to build a fiber-to-the-home project to provide 1,750 co-op members access to a state-of-the-art network, the company announced today. Service will be available at speeds of up to 1 gigabit per second with no data limits sometime in the latter part of 2017. The co-op will…

Otsego Electric Coop Elevates Its Longtime Attorney To CEO

Otsego Electric Coop Elevates Its Longtime Attorney To CEO Tim Johnson HARTWICK – Timothy R. Johnson of Edmeston, former legal counsel to the National Rural Electric Cooperative Association, has joined Otsego Electric Cooperative as chief executive officer. A lifelong Otsego County resident and OEC attorney for almost 30 years, the new CEO succeeds Steve Rinell, who resigned.
